Enterprise integration software is the control plane for connecting cloud apps, on-prem systems, and data flows through APIs, events, and workflow orchestration. Microsoft Azure Integration Services

cloud integration

Azure Integration Services combines Azure Logic Apps, Azure API Management, and Azure Service Bus to implement API and event-driven integrations.

Microsoft Azure Integration Services stands out by unifying managed integration building blocks across enterprise app connectivity and event-driven messaging. Logic Apps delivers visual workflow orchestration with connectors for SaaS, enterprise systems, and custom APIs. Azure Service Bus and Event Grid provide reliable messaging, pub-sub routing, and event triggers for distributed workloads. API Management supports consistent API publishing, security policies, and traffic control for integrated services.

Red Hat Integration

enterprise integration

Red Hat Integration provides enterprise integration tooling for message transformation, API exposure, and connectivity across hybrid environments.

Red Hat Integration stands out for combining a messaging backbone with integration runtime capabilities under a single enterprise support model. It includes AMQ streams for event streaming, Fuse for service integration and routing, and SSO and identity integration for enterprise deployments. Core capabilities cover API and integration orchestration, message-driven integration patterns, and connectivity across common enterprise systems. Deployment targets span containers and Kubernetes, which helps standardize environments across development, test, and production.

What Is Enterprise Integration Software?

Enterprise integration software connects applications, APIs, events, and data flows across cloud and on-prem environments while enforcing security, transformation, and operational visibility. It solves problems like integrating SaaS with legacy systems, publishing and securing APIs, and coordinating multi-step processes using workflow orchestration or event-driven routing. Tools like Microsoft Azure Integration Services combine Logic Apps orchestration with Service Bus and Event Grid messaging to implement event triggers and reliable queues. Tools like MuleSoft Anypoint Platform implement API-led integration with API governance through API Manager and runtime execution through Mule runtime engines.
